Abstract

The utility model discloses a combined device for rapid and convenient cleaning of obstetrical membrane breaking amniotic fluid drainage, which comprises a box body, wherein a bottom plate is arranged at the lower end of the box body, a plurality of universal wheels are arranged at the bottom end of the bottom plate, a connecting piece is arranged at the upper end of one side of the box body, a connecting sleeve is arranged at one side of the connecting piece, an adjusting rod is arranged at the upper end of the connecting sleeve, a membrane breaking device is arranged at one end of a drainage tube, which is away from a negative pressure drainage device, a connecting groove is arranged at the upper end of one side of the box body, a water tank is arranged in the box body and below the connecting groove, a sprinkler is arranged in the connecting groove, a limiting clamping plate is arranged at the upper end of the connecting groove, the membrane breaking device is connected with the limiting clamping plate, a water pump is arranged at the upper end of the water tank, a water inlet pipe connected with the sprinkler is arranged on the water pump, a drain pipe is connected between the lower end of one side of the connecting groove and the water tank, and a filter is arranged in the middle of the drain pipe. Has the advantages that: can directly clean and disinfect the membrane rupture device, has very high practicability and certain popularization value.

For the convenience of understanding the technical solutions of the present invention, the following detailed description will be made on the working principle or the operation mode of the present invention in the practical process.
In practical application, the push-pull handle 23 is used, so that the whole carrying movement of the box body 1 is facilitated under the universal wheels 3, by aligning the membrane rupturing device 13 to the private part of the lying-in woman, and controlling the display screen 7 to suck the amniotic fluid in the uterus of the lying-in woman into the waste liquid collecting tank 8 by using the membrane rupturing device 13 and the negative pressure drainage device 10 connected with the drainage tube 12, after the amniotic fluid is discharged through the liquid outlet pipe and extracted, the membrane rupture device 13 is placed on the limiting clamping plate 17 on the connecting groove 14 and after being placed, the disinfectant in the connecting groove 14 is sprayed to the surface of the membrane rupturing device 13 through the sprayer 16 for primary cleaning by starting the water pump 18, during the cleaning process, the motor 24 drives the cleaning sponge brush 26 on the rotary L-shaped arm 25 to rotate, scrubbing is carried out on the membrane rupture device 13 to avoid that the liquid attached to the membrane rupture device cannot be cleaned, and then the ultraviolet disinfection lamp 27 is started to carry out secondary cleaning.
